Let the kinetic energy is K and masses of bodies are m1 and m2.For first body, p1=2m1K∴ p12=2m1K …(i)Similarly, for second body, p22=2m2K …(ii)Dividing Eq. (i) by Eq. (ii), we getp12p22=2m1K2m2K,p1p2=m1m2⇒ p1p2= square root of masses.
